TRAIL HELPS RECOVER THE STOLEN MOTORBIKE


BY Obakeng Maje

Rustenburg- On Friday, 8 June, between 00:30 and 02:30, the 40-year old mine worker allegedly lost his motorbike that is his only mode of transport to Lonmin mines.

The motorbike was allegedly stolen from a complex in Kroondal, Rustenburg. The security members working at the complex helped him look for it.

 

They started following the tracks right through the dry riverbed until it reached a shack in Matebeleng township walk distance from the mall.

The police and Community Police Forum (CPF) assisted in gaining entry to the locked shack. 

 “The stolen motorbike worth the value of R8 000.00 was found inside the shack, later handed back to its rightful owner and no one arrest as the shack owner was not present” Sergeant Nkwalase said.
